Comparison review

The Xperia 1 II is way better than Xiaomi Redmi Note 8T, getting a global score of 91 against 75.6. The Xperia 1 II is a just a little bit lighter and just a little thinner phone than Xiaomi Redmi Note 8T, even though they were released only a few months apart. Both devices we compare here have Android OS (operating system), but the Xperia 1 II has 11 version while Xiaomi Redmi Note 8T has Android 9.0 Pie.

The Xperia 1 II has a bit better processing power than Xiaomi Redmi Note 8T, and although they both have a Octa-Core processor, the Xperia 1 II also has more RAM. The Xperia 1 II counts with a more vivid screen than Xiaomi Redmi Note 8T, because it has a bit larger display, much more pixels per inch of screen and a lot higher resolution of 1644 x 3840px.

The Sony Xperia 1 II counts with a much greater storage to store more apps and games than Xiaomi Redmi Note 8T, because it has 224 GB more internal storage capacity and an external memory slot that supports a maximum of 1000 GB. Xiaomi Redmi Note 8T shoots slightly better videos and photos than Sony Xperia 1 II, because although it has a tinier back-facing camera sensor which offers a worse image and video quality, a smaller aperture and slower 30 frames per second video frame rates, and they both have the same (4K) video definition, the Xiaomi Redmi Note 8T also counts with a camera with a lot better 48 megapixels resolution.

The Sony Xperia 1 II and Xiaomi Redmi Note 8T count with extremely similar battery durations.
